Water Leak and Landlord-Tenant Issue at 426 Van Houten Avenue
Source: East Rutherford Fire and Police
East Rutherford, NJ, USA
Summary: Fire and police units responded to a reported water leak at 426 Van Houten Avenue, East Rutherford, New Jersey. Upon arrival, responders found water leaking into a bar area from the second floor, which had been ongoing for about 20 minutes. Attempts to access the affected apartment were initially unsuccessful, but entry was later forced with police assistance. The leak was traced to a toilet in apartment number two and was identified as a recurring issue, possibly related to a landlord-tenant dispute. The power to the affected area was secured, and the incident was resolved without injury.
